This was delicious and very easy to make. I made extra chicken the night before and used the leftovers. I also used Bisquick brand baking mix for the crust - I just made the biscuit recipe on the box and rolled it out thin. One thing I will change though. The store bought pesto sauce has raw garlic and it doesn't cook completely so it is a bit acidic, so next time I will use my homemade roasted garlic pesto.
